McLaren F1 (240.1 Miles Per Hour)

McLaren F1

Jonathan Palmer supposedly drove the F1 model XP3 around Italy’s Nardo test track at 231 mph, the creation units’ restricted maximum velocity, yet on March 31, 1998, racecar driver Andy Wallace steered the delimited McLaren model XP5 to a normal of 240.1 miles each hour at Volkswagen’s Ehra-Lessien test track. It actually holds the crown for the world’s quickest creation vehicle with a normally suctioned motor.

BUGATTI VEYRON 16.4 (253.8 Miles Per Hour)

Bugatti Veyron 16.4

Bugatti set the entire world into a maximum velocity fit when it asserted that it arrived at the midpoint of 253.8 miles each hour on April 19, 2005, with its then-new million-dollar supercar, the Bugatti Veyron 16.4. Bugatti was hoping to turn into the world’s quickest creation vehicle, in any event, setting up the vehicle efficiently for the errand with a Top Speed mode that shut a couple of diffuser folds toward the front and adjusted the back spoiler to the body.

BUGATTI CHIRON SUPERSPORT 300+ (304 miles per hour)

Bugatti Chiron Super Sport 300+

The Bugatti Chiron Super Sport as of late acquired a crown as the quickest vehicle on the planet. Working with Dallara to advance the streamlined features, the most recent Bugatti Chiron was timed at 304.773 miles each hour at the Volkswagen demonstrating grounds close to Wolfsburg, Germany in August of 2019. It was a single-direction run because the track surface so ineligible for a world record.
